Niklas advises mid-market companies, start-ups, stock corporations and European stock corporations (SE), as well as their shareholders and board members, on all aspects of corporate law – from day-to-day advisory work to complex transactions such as M&A deals, joint ventures and restructurings.

He has a particular focus on corporate law, advising both publicly listed and private companies. In the area of corporate transactions, he acts for clients on both the buy side and the sell side.

On restructurings, he supports companies with internal reorganisations as well as mergers, hive-downs, demergers and conversions.

Niklas completed his legal traineeship in Stuttgart, where he gained experience as a research associate and as a trainee at a mid-market commercial law firm and in the legal department of a listed stock corporation. He studied law at the University of Tübingen.

Grifols S.A.

Osborne Clarke advised Grifols, the major shareholder of Biotest AG, on the conversion of Biotest AG into a partnership limited by shares (Kommanditgesellschaft auf Aktien – KGaA). Read more.
